EXV2080 TV Motherboard and Panel integrated Tester is a device that can test both LCD module
and TV motherboard at the same time. EXV2080 adopts multi-core processor architecture design to
test 4K-VBY1 LCD module and 2K-LVDS LCD module. EXV2080 can test LVDS motherboard, test
VBY1 motherboard, test MINILVDS motherboard with powerful function (For those unfamiliar with
these signals, please read this manual carefully. With the EDP module (additional procurement
required), it can also test the EDP signal LCD module of notebook.


 When testing LCD module, EXV2080 supports image signal types with various resolutions and
formats, and has strong compatibility. It can output a variety of test images, such as solid color,
color bar, gray scale, animation, etc., and can track a single bad point on the LCD module, avoiding
the situation of misjudgment, making the test more perfect and judgment more accurate.


 When testing TV motherboard, it can test two groups of FHD LVDS signals at the same time, so the
test is more comprehensive. At the same time, EXV2080 also has its own image-detail display
function, which makes the characters clearer when adjusting the LCD module parameters. The
built-in LCD can achieve local definition equivalent to 1600 * 960 in magnification mode. When the
external display is connected, the dual screen display function can be achieved, and the local
definition in the magnification mode is equivalent to that of 2K display.


 EXV2080 has its own operation interface, which can be directly seen all parameters of TV
motherboard and LCD module. EXV2080 also has its internal protection circuit. When VLCD and
GND are short circuited, it can automatically judge and prohibit output.

 EXV2080 with micro USB data upgrade interface, support software upgrade. When there is a new
demand, you can upgrade the firmware to maintain its best compatibility

Detailed Images


Front panel 

1. VLCD output indicator light---when there is VLCD voltage output,the light will be on
2. LVDSsignal interface --- output LVDS or input LVDS (or MINILVDS) signal
3. VBY1-4K signal output interface — output VBY1 signal
4. 4.HDMIinterface --- output HDMI signal
5. Type A USB port---Reserved
6. Powersocket---12V power input
7. Extron use only
8. Up / Mode key --- move cursor up, or switch forward the image, or image mode adjustment
9. Down / Switch key --- move cursor down, or switch back image, or 4K image dual screen adjustment
10. Left / Odd-even key --- move the cursor to the left, or auto switch image, or LVDS signal groups Odd-even order switch
11. Right / Full screen key --- move the cursor to the right,or auto switch image,or enter and exit full screen display mode
12. Confirm / Scale key --- confirm the current cursor position parameter, or SCAL the image (scale 4x local image)
13. Resetkey --- reset all function
14. MicroUSBport --- online firmware upgrade socket
